Subtractive procedures remove copper from a completely copper-coated board to depart only the desired copper sample. The simplest approach, utilized for smaller-scale creation and often by hobbyists, is immersion etching, by which the board is submerged in etching Remedy for instance ferric chloride. Compared with procedures used for mass output, the etching time is long. Warmth and agitation could be placed on the bathtub to speed the etching charge. In bubble etching, air is handed from the etchant tub to agitate the solution and speed up etching. Splash etching employs a motor-pushed paddle to splash boards with etchant; the procedure is now commercially out of date because It is far from as quick as spray etching. In spray etching, the etchant Remedy is distributed above the boards by nozzles, and recirculated by pumps. Adjustment in the nozzle pattern, flow fee, temperature, and etchant composition presents predictable Charge of etching charges and higher generation costs.

Originally, each Digital ingredient had wire prospects, as well as a PCB Manufacturer PCB experienced holes drilled for every wire of each and every ingredient. The component prospects were then inserted with the holes and soldered towards the copper PCB traces. This method of assembly known as by way of-gap building. In 1949, Moe Abramson and Stanislaus File. Danko of the United States Army Signal Corps made the Automobile-Sembly procedure in which ingredient qualified prospects were being inserted into a copper foil interconnection sample and dip soldered.
